AFR

A mockumentary that interweaves reality and fiction into the construction of a drama.The director has deceived and manipulated leading world politicians, as well as politicians in his own country, thereby creating a provocative, entertaining satire that gives food for thought.The film, however, develops into a moving story about two people who experience the love of their life. AFR is a comment on the reality of modern media and on events in the international political arena. Even if AFR at the beginning informs the viewer that it is an orchestration of an outrageous lie, the audience is left to ponder the question: Was it really a lie?

Morten Hartz Kaplers

He was born in Denmark in 1971 and studied at Prague’s FAMU. A curator for international contemporary art exhibitions, and trapeze artist in the 1990s, he worked as a professional production director in television, commercials, and music videos. He is a member of the Danish Independent Filmmakers’ Film School SUPER 16. He received a 2-year scholarship from the Danish Arts Council. Sisyfos’ World won the first prize at the CloseUp national short film competition 1997. He wrote and directed the award winning short films Love and Power and Orchid. AFR is his first feature.
